Statutory minimums aren't the same for both sides

Under the Employment Rights Act 1996, the legal minimum notice an employer must give an employee rises with length of service — one week after a month's service, then an extra week for each full year worked, up to a cap of 12 weeks for anyone with 12 or more years' service. The minimum an employee must give when resigning works differently: it's a flat one week once you've worked a month, regardless of how long you've been there, unless your contract specifies something longer. In practice, most employment contracts set a longer notice period than either statutory minimum on both sides — a month or more is common — and whichever is longer, the contractual period or the statutory one, is what actually applies.

Does this account for weekends or bank holidays?

No — a notice period is calendar time, not working days, so the last day shown may fall on a weekend if your notice period lands there. Your actual last working day in the office would then be the working day before or after, depending on your contract.

What if my notice period is in months and I give notice at the end of a month?

This is handled automatically — for example, one month's notice given on 31 January correctly lands on 28 February (or 29 in a leap year), not an invalid date like 31 February.

What's the statutory minimum notice period if my contract doesn't say?

For an employee resigning, it's one week once you've worked at least a month. For an employer, it starts at one week and rises with length of service, capped at 12 weeks — check your contract first, since most specify a longer period than the legal minimum.
